Is it possible to connect a beolab 3500 to a beosound 1 - somehow or other!

carlito replied on Tue, Nov 6 2012 3:53 PM

Defenitive no chance!

Cheapest way to build up a Masterlink Network is buying a used Beosound Ouverture - or an Beomaster4500 / 6500 / 7000, Beocenter 2300 with using a Masterlink-Converter

Chris Harrison:

Is it possible to connect a beolab 3500 to a beosound 1 - somehow or other!

BL3500 is Masterlink only AFAIK;  moreover, on Page 5 of the Userguide it's written:

"Note: Although BeoLab 3500 has a Power Link socket, it can not be used as an ordinary Power Link loudspeaker in a audio or video system! "

So, no way !
